General Information

Title: The Lord is Arriving
Composer: Tim Risher
Source of text: Translation of the antiphon Dominus veniet, occurrite illi, dicentes

Number of voices: 4vv   Voicing: SATB

Genre: SacredAntiphon

Language: English
Instruments: Organ

Original text and translations

English.png English text

The Lord is arriving;
go out and meet him, and say:
he is the first beginning,
his reign shall have no end:
God is the almighty,
Lord and Prince of peace,
Alleluia.
